IGMBaseLib 1.0
Modules | Functions/Subroutines

src/util/math/FVM_HDiff_operator.f90 File Reference

Go to the source code of this file.

Modules

module  FVM_HDiff_operator
 

正二十面体格子の一つの格子点に対して, 物理場の微分(勾配, 発散, 回転)を評価するためのサブルーチンを提供するモジュール.


Functions/Subroutines

real(DP), dimension(ret_dim),
public 
FVM_HDiff_operator::eval_div_operator (val_GP0, val_CV, GP0, CV, CVArea, ic_radius, CV_num, val_dim, ret_dim)
real(DP), dimension(ret_dim),
public 
FVM_HDiff_operator::eval_rot_operator (val_GP0, val_CV, GP0, CV, CVArea, ic_radius, CV_num, val_dim, ret_dim)
real(DP), dimension(ret_dim),
public 
FVM_HDiff_operator::eval_grad_operator (val_GP0, val_CV, GP0, CV, CVArea, ic_radius, CV_num, val_dim, ret_dim)
real(DP) FVM_HDiff_operator::div_operator (vec_CV, pt_CV, CVArea, pt_size, ic_radius)
 ベクトル場の水平発散を計算する.
real(DP) FVM_HDiff_operator::rot_operator (vec_CV, pt_CV, CVArea, pt_size, ic_radius)
 水平ベクトル場の回転の鉛直成分を計算する.
real(DP), dimension(3) FVM_HDiff_operator::grad_operator (q_GP0, q_CV, pt_CV, CVArea, pt_size, ic_radius)
 2 次元のスカラー場の水平勾配を計算する.
real(DP), dimension(3) FVM_HDiff_operator::grad_operator2 (q_GP0, q_CV, GP, pt_CV, CVArea, pt_size, ic_radius)
 All Classes Namespaces Files Functions Variables